Can Diet and Exercise Help ADHD? What Science Says About Natural Supports
This article explains what research says about using diet and exercise as natural supports for ADHD. Studies show regular aerobic activity can modestly improve attention, impulse control, and mood, while balanced eating patterns (such as a Mediterranean-style diet), omega-3 fatty acids, and correcting low iron, zinc, or vitamin D may help some people. Evidence for eliminating artificial colors or specific foods applies to a subset of sensitive children; sugar itself isn’t a proven trigger. These approaches don’t replace medication or behavioral therapy, but they can be safe, accessible add-ons to a personalized plan. Patients and caregivers will find clear, evidence-based takeaways and practical questions to discuss with their clinicians.
